New York Requirements (What You Must Know)

Minimum Liability

Current NY minimums are $25,000/$50,000 bodily injury and $10,000 property damage. We’ll quote higher limits that better fit Osceola’s rural exposure.

No-Fault and Motorcycles

NY’s no-fault benefits do not apply to motorcycles. Add Medical Payments (MedPay) to help with medical expenses regardless of fault.

Helmet & Eye Protection

NY has a universal helmet law for operators and passengers under 18; riders 18+ must wear if operating with a learner’s permit. Use approved helmets and eye protection.

Inspection & Lane Splitting

NY requires annual inspections for motorcycles. Lane splitting is not permitted-follow traffic laws carefully.

Build the Right Coverage for Osceola Riding

Liability (BI/PD)

  • Start at $100k/$300k or $250k/$500k BI in rural areas
  • Property Damage: $25k-$50k common

UM/UIM

  • Match to your BI limits to protect you from underinsured drivers
  • Stacking options vary by carrier

MedPay

  • Helps with medical bills regardless of fault
  • Popular limits: $5k-$25k

Comprehensive & Collision

  • Theft, vandalism, weather, animal strikes, crash damage
  • Choose deductibles that fit your cash cushion

Custom Parts / Accessories

  • Most policies include a small amount automatically (e.g., $1,000)
  • Schedule added value for luggage, bars, windscreens, lighting, seats

Getting Your NY Motorcycle Endorsement

Course Path (Recommended)

  • Enroll in an approved Basic RiderCourse (BRC)
  • Pass the course; bring completion card to DMV
  • Add the M endorsement

Permit + Testing Path

  • Get motorcycle examination permit (knowledge + vision)
  • Practice under permit restrictions
  • Take DMV road test; add M endorsement

Bike Size & Restrictions

Testing on a small-displacement bike can trigger restrictions. Completing an approved course typically removes this-ask us if you’re unsure.
